The Northside L Lions waltzed into their matchup on Thursday with 12 straight wins but they left with 13. They snuck past Benton HomeSchool with a 44-40 win. That's another feather in the cap for Northside L, who also won these teams' last head-to-head.
Northside L was led to victory by DUKE KARNES and JOEY HEASTON. KARNES scored 14 points along with six steals and five rebounds, while HEASTON scored 14 points along with seven steals. The team also got some help courtesy of BEN HEASTON, who scored six points along with five rebounds and two steals.
Northside L has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won 15 of their last 17 games, which provided a nice bump to their 29-4 record this season. As for Benton HomeSchool,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 18-12.
